FARNBOROUGH AIR SHOW --- Asiana Airlines has selected Pratt & Whitney PW4000-112 engines to power three new Boeing 777-200ER aircraft in a deal valued at more than US$135 million. The contract includes installed engines and a long-term service agreement provided by Pratt & Whitney Global Service Partners
FARNBOROUGH, England --- Northrop Grumman Corporation's Tanker team announced today that all four initial tanker System Design and Development (SDD) airframes are scheduled for final assembly and initial flight testing by the end of 2009. The first two SDD airframes have been built and flown, and are awaiting modification to the tanker configuration

The Dlgation gnrale pour larmement (DGA), the French defence procurement agency, on July 1, 2008 certified the fully omnirole version of the Rafale combat aircraft, designated F3. The first production F3 aircraft will be delivered in early 2009, while aircraft already in service will be upgraded to this latest standard
The Dlgation gnrale pour larmement (DGA), the French defence procurement agency, has awarded Thales an order for nine Damocls target acquisition pods. The first pod, ordered previously, will be delivered in mid-2009, and will be used for systems integration on the Mirage 2000D combat aircraft of the French air force
The Vanguard class submarine HMS Victorious has left Plymouth today, Thursday 10 July 2008, after completing her three and a half year multi-million pound overhaul at Devonport Royal Dockyard.>> Victorious is heading to Scotland for sea trials that mark the start of a process of regeneration of the platform and crew to operational status following her Long Overhaul Period (Refuel) [LOP(R)]
